SUMNER, WA (June 24, 2024) – Early Wednesday, one victim was killed and another was arrested after a DUI collision on State Route 167.
Authorities responded to the scene just after 4:20 a.m., near State Route 410 on June 5th.
Reports indicate that the driver of a northbound vehicle veered off the road while heading north.
The northbound vehicle then crashed into the center median before striking another car that was heading west on State Route 410. In addition, a third vehicle became involved.
Medics pronounced the driver of the vehicle that was hit dead at the scene. Although, police have not yet released their name or place of residency.
Moreover, tow-trucks were dispatched to the scene to clear out all the wreckage. Following preliminary duties, police arrested the suspect and he was determined to be intoxicated. He was charged with DUI and vehicular homicide.
An active investigation to determine further information about the fatal DUI collision on State Route 167 is underway.
